Summary:
Teach Yourself Thai is the course for anyone who wants to progress quickly from the basics to understanding, speaking and writing Thai with confidence.

Although aimed at those with no previous knowledge, it is equally suitable for anyone wishing to brush up existing knowledge or refresh rusty language skills for a holiday or business trip.

Key structures and vocabulary are introduced in 14 thematic units progressing from introducing yourself and dealing with everyday situations to making travel arrangements. The emphasis is on communication throughout with important language structures introduced through dialogues on the accompanying recording.

The book will give you a solid introduction to the Thai writing system, so you can go on to extend your knowledge beyond the book and the recorded material will help you with the pronunciation of this tonal language.

The new edition retains the tried-and-tested structure of the lessons but has been fully updated. New features include an English-Thai vocabulary to go alongside the existing Thai-English vocabulary and a 'taking it further' section directing the reader to further sources of Thai - websites, books, etc. The language notes have been expanded, the exercises improved and more reading material in Thai script added.

The page design has been improved and section headings given in English to make the course easier to use for the self-access learner. The accompanying recording has been increased to two accompanying cassettes or CDs amounting to approximately 150 minutes of listening material.

The CDs and cassettes are available separately or in a pack with the book.

About the Author(s):
David Smyth spent several years teaching at universities in Thailand before taking up a post as Lecturer in Thai at the School of Oriental and African Studies at the University of London.
